#7ff425 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ff425 is composed of 49.8% red, 95.7%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#7ff425 color hex could be obtained by blending #feff4a with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#7ff425 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ff425 has RGB values of R:127, G:244,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 8385573.

Shades and Tints of #7ff425
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f8f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ff425
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9386 is the less saturated color, while #7efd1c is the most saturated one.
